Can't happen ....55. What are the rules for retired players?
There's nothing binding about a player announcing his retirement. The player can still sign a new contract and continue playing (if he's not under contract), or return to his team (if he is still under contract) and resume his career.
The only exception to this is when a player is still under contract, wants to quit, and his team doesn't want to let him out of his contract. Under these circumstances the player can file for retirement with the league. The player is placed on the league's Voluntarily Retired list, forgoes his remaining salary, and cannot return to the league for one year. The latter requirement prevents players from using retirement as an underhanded way to change teams, but can be overridden with unanimous approval from all 30 teams.
Essentially the team he retires from still ownes his rights until his contract would have expired except for his early retirement ... in Sheed's case another two years. If he comes back it's for the team he's been traded to or nobody unless he wants to come back in 2012 and sign a new contract.
So, please put an end to your fantasy of trading Sheed and then having him come back to the C's in Feb. Can't happen, give it up.
